rather interesting...i assume you cant long press to get rid of them? are they clickable, as in opens the app? if not, have you tried to change wallpapers?

if none of the above fix it, i would imagine it has something to do with the launcher. so you could either download a third party launcher like nova launcher or apex laucher OR you could go to settings>apps>slide over to all apps>find the stock launcher (i think its called homescreen???) and clear data.
